Defogging and Defrosting
Fog on the inside of windows is a result of high
humidity (moisture) condensing on the cool window
glass. This can be minimized if the climate control
system is used properly. There are two modes to choose
from to clear fog or frost from your windshield. Use
the defog mode to clear the windows of fog or moisture
and warm the passengers. Use the defrost mode to
remove fog or frost from the windshield more quickly.
Turn the right knob clockwise or counterclockwise
to select one of the following modes:
-(Defog): This mode directs the air to the floor
outlets, windshield and side window outlets. The
recirculation button cannot be selected while in
defog mode.
1(Defrost): This mode directs most of the air to the
windshield and the side window outlets, with only a
little air directed to the floor outlets. The air conditioning
compressor may run to dehumidify the air to prevent
window fogging. The recirculation button cannot
be selected while in defrost mode. Do not drive the
vehicle until all the windows are clear.
Rear Window Defogger
Your vehicle may have this feature. The lines you see
on the rear window warm the glass.
< (Rear): Press this button to turn the rear window
defogger on or off. An indicator light in the button
will come on to let you know that the rear window
defogger is active. The rear window defogger will
automatically turn off approximately ten minutes after
the button is pressed.
If your vehicle is equipped with heated mirrors, this
button will activate them.
Notice: Do not use anything sharp on the inside
of the rear window. If you do, you could cut or
damage the warming grid, and the repairs would
not be covered by your warranty. Do not attach
a temporary vehicle license, tape, a decal or
anything similar to the defogger grid.
